Barbequed Beef Sandwiches
- 4 pounds beef chuck boneless
- 2 cups water
- 1 each onions stuck with 3 whole cloves
- 2 each bay leaves
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1/2 cup onions finely chopped
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on prepared mustard dried
- 1 cup ketchup
- 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ar or white vinegar
- 2 tablespoons worcestershire sauce
- Place meat, water, onion, bay leaf in pressure cooker.
- Cook 30 minutes, allow vent to cool down on its own.
- (Or, if preferred, double the amount of water and simmer in a heavy saucepot until tender, about 3 hours).
- Remove meat and reserve one cup of broth.
- Discard the onion and bay leaves.
- Cut and (or) shred beef into bite-sized pieces.
- In small pan melt butter, saute chopped onion until tender and golden.
- Add all the remaining ingredients, along with the reserved broth, to the onions and simmer for 5 to 10 minutes.
- Pour sauce over meat.
- Simmer 30 minutes.
- Serve on rolls or bread.
- (Keeps well in a crockpot - can be taken to picnics, potlucks, etc.
- Leftovers freeze well).
